Richard Bruton (Dublin North Central, Fine Gael)
I wish to make some brief comments. I am content to allow the guarantee scheme to operate with the Minister having discretion to apply it on the understanding that he will return to the House with the scheme and provide us with an opportunity to approve it and not on the basis that we must have a Private Members' motion seeking to annul it. We need Government time committed to presenting this for debate and providing an opportunity for the House to sanction or reject it.
A rumour circulated throughout the House that the Minister would indicate in his reply that provision would be made for positive approval by the Dáil. However, I did not hear it stated in his remarks. Perhaps I momentarily nodded off.
